Why does my floor in Downtown Nelsonville feel dry but your meter says it's still wet?
Surface dryness is a psychrometric illusion. The vapor pressure within the material remains elevated. Our IICRC S500 protocols require drying to a structural equilibrium of 38 Grains Per Pound (GPP) at 70°F. Achieving this standard prevents residual moisture from migrating and causing secondary damage.
What's the difference between 'grey water' and 'black water' for my insurance claim?
Category 2 'grey water' from appliance overflows contains significant contamination. Category 3 'black water' from sewage or flooding is grossly contaminated. Protocols differ drastically. What should I do first when I discover a major leak?
Immediately shut off the main water valve. This is the critical first step in 'loss of use' mitigation to stop the flow. For properties near Stuart's Opera House, rapid utility shut-off prevents cascading damage and is a documented factor in claim severity reduction.
